<p>Investing in home improvements can make your house more comfortable and increase its resale value. Not all renovations offer the same return, so it’s important to choose projects wisely. Here are the top 10 improvements that homeowners should consider:</p>



<p><strong>1. Kitchen Remodels</strong><br>The kitchen is often the heart of the home. Modernizing cabinets, countertops, and appliances can significantly boost your property’s appeal. Even small updates like new handles, lighting, or backsplashes make a difference.</p>



<p><strong>2. Bathroom Upgrades</strong><br>Updating bathrooms—think new tiles, fixtures, or a fresh coat of paint—offers a strong return on investment. Consider installing water-efficient toilets and faucets to appeal to eco-conscious buyers.</p>



<p><strong>3. Energy-Efficient Windows</strong><br>Replacing old windows with energy-efficient ones reduces heating and cooling costs and improves curb appeal. Homeowners love windows that let in light and save money.</p>



<p><strong>4. Roof Replacement or Repairs</strong><br>A new or well-maintained roof protects the home and adds value. Buyers notice damage or aging roofs, so investing here can prevent future problems.</p>



<p><strong>5. Painting and Curb Appeal</strong><br>A fresh coat of paint, both inside and outside, gives your home a clean, modern look. Combine this with landscaping improvements for maximum impact.</p>



<p><strong>6. Flooring Upgrades</strong><br>Replace outdated carpets with hardwood, laminate, or modern tiles. Quality flooring is attractive and lasts for years, giving your home a polished feel.</p>



<p><strong>7. Home Insulation and Energy Systems</strong><br>Enhancing insulation, upgrading HVAC systems, or installing solar panels makes your home more energy-efficient—a big selling point for future buyers.</p>



<p><strong>8. Basement and Attic Conversions</strong><br>Transform unused spaces into functional areas like home offices, gyms, or extra bedrooms. Finished basements or attics add square footage and appeal.</p>



<p><strong>9. Smart Home Features</strong><br>Installing smart thermostats, lighting, or security systems modernizes your home. Tech-savvy buyers appreciate energy-saving and convenience features.</p>



<p><strong>10. Decks, Patios, and Outdoor Spaces</strong><br>Outdoor living spaces are highly desirable. Adding or upgrading a deck, patio, or garden area can significantly increase property value and appeal to families and entertainers.</p>
